Skip to content

Commit

Permalink
Merge pull request #98 from ritsec/main
Browse files Browse the repository at this point in the history
Bring staging up to main
  • Loading branch information
c0untingNumbers committed Apr 26, 2024
2 parents 877d8ae + cdb1537 commit d88d951
Show file tree
Hide file tree
Showing 12 changed files with 58 additions and 41 deletions.
2 changes: 1 addition & 1 deletion commands/handlers/angryreact.go
Original file line number Diff line number Diff line change
Expand Up @@ -53,7 +53,7 @@ func AngryReact(s *discordgo.Session, m *discordgo.MessageCreate) {
Label: "View Message",
URL: helpers.JumpURL(m.Message),
Style: discordgo.LinkButton,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"👀",
},
},
Expand Down
4 changes: 2 additions & 2 deletions commands/handlers/audit.go
Original file line number Diff line number Diff line change
Expand Up @@ -25,7 +25,7 @@ func MemberJoin(s *discordgo.Session, m *discordgo.GuildMemberAdd) {
Label: "View Profile",
URL: fmt.Sprintf("https://discordapp.com/users/%v/", m.Member.User.ID),
Style: discordgo.LinkButton,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"👀",
},
},
Expand Down Expand Up @@ -54,7 +54,7 @@ func MemberLeave(s *discordgo.Session, m *discordgo.GuildMemberRemove) {
Label: "View Profile",
URL: fmt.Sprintf("https://discordapp.com/users/%v/", m.Member.User.ID),
Style: discordgo.LinkButton,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"👀",
},
},
Expand Down
2 changes: 1 addition & 1 deletion commands/handlers/isTheStackRunning.go
Original file line number Diff line number Diff line change
Expand Up @@ -34,7 +34,7 @@ func IsTheStackRunning(s *discordgo.Session, m *discordgo.MessageCreate) {
Label: "View Message",
URL: helpers.JumpURL(message),
Style: discordgo.LinkButton,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"👀",
},
},
Expand Down
2 changes: 1 addition & 1 deletion commands/handlers/uwu.go
Original file line number Diff line number Diff line change
Expand Up @@ -33,7 +33,7 @@ func Uwu(s *discordgo.Session, m *discordgo.MessageCreate) {
Label: "View Message",
URL: helpers.JumpURL(message),
Style: discordgo.LinkButton,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"👀",
},
},
Expand Down
6 changes: 3 additions & 3 deletions commands/scheduled/goodfood.go
Original file line number Diff line number Diff line change
Expand Up @@ -44,7 +44,7 @@ func sendGoodFoodPing(s *discordgo.Session, location string, ctx ddtrace.SpanCon
Label: "View Message",
URL: helpers.JumpURL(message),
Style: discordgo.LinkButton,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"👀",
},
},
Expand Down Expand Up @@ -76,7 +76,7 @@ func GoodFood(s *discordgo.Session, quit chan interface{}) error {
}

// 11:00 AM
must(c.AddFunc("0 0 11 * * MON", func() {})) // Monday
must(c.AddFunc("0 0 11 * * MON", func() { sendGoodFoodPing(s, "RITZ", span.Context()) })) // Monday
must(c.AddFunc("0 0 11 * * TUE", func() { sendGoodFoodPing(s, "Crossroads", span.Context()) })) // Tuesday
must(c.AddFunc("0 0 11 * * WED", func() { sendGoodFoodPing(s, "Brick City", span.Context()) })) // Wednesday
must(c.AddFunc("0 0 11 * * THU", func() {})) // Thursday
Expand All @@ -85,7 +85,7 @@ func GoodFood(s *discordgo.Session, quit chan interface{}) error {
must(c.AddFunc("0 0 11 * * SUN", func() {})) // Sunday

// 4:00 PM
must(c.AddFunc("0 0 16 * * MON", func() { sendGoodFoodPing(s, "RITZ", span.Context()) })) // Monday
must(c.AddFunc("0 0 16 * * MON", func() {})) // Monday
must(c.AddFunc("0 0 16 * * TUE", func() {})) // Tuesday
must(c.AddFunc("0 0 16 * * WED", func() { sendGoodFoodPing(s, "RITZ", span.Context()) })) // Wednesday
must(c.AddFunc("0 0 16 * * THU", func() { sendGoodFoodPing(s, "Crossroads", span.Context()) })) // Thursday
Expand Down
4 changes: 2 additions & 2 deletions commands/slash/kudos.go
Original file line number Diff line number Diff line change
Expand Up @@ -208,15 +208,15 @@ func Kudos() (*discordgo.ApplicationCommand, func(s *discordgo.Session, i *disco
Label: "Approve",
Style: discordgo.SuccessButton,
CustomID: approve_slug,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"✔️",
},
},
discordgo.Button{
Label: "Deny",
Style: discordgo.DangerButton,
CustomID: deny_slug,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"✖️",
},
},
Expand Down
36 changes: 18 additions & 18 deletions commands/slash/member.go
Original file line number Diff line number Diff line change
Expand Up @@ -228,15 +228,15 @@ func tooManyAttempts(s *discordgo.Session, i *discordgo.InteractionCreate, attem
Label: "Yes",
Style: discordgo.SuccessButton,
CustomID: yesSlug,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"✔️",
},
},
discordgo.Button{
Label: "No",
Style: discordgo.DangerButton,
CustomID: noSlug,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"✖️",
},
},
Expand Down Expand Up @@ -309,15 +309,15 @@ func emailInUse(s *discordgo.Session, i *discordgo.InteractionCreate, userEmail
Label: "Yes",
Style: discordgo.SuccessButton,
CustomID: yesSlug,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"✔️",
},
},
discordgo.Button{
Label: "No",
Style: discordgo.DangerButton,
CustomID: noSlug,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"✖️",
},
},
Expand Down Expand Up @@ -488,15 +488,15 @@ func recievedEmail(s *discordgo.Session, i *discordgo.InteractionCreate, userEma
CustomID: recievedSlug,
Label: "I recieved the code",
Style: discordgo.SuccessButton,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"✔️",
},
},
discordgo.Button{
CustomID: unrecievedSlug,
Label: "I did not recieve the code",
Style: discordgo.DangerButton,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"✖️",
},
},
Expand Down Expand Up @@ -556,15 +556,15 @@ func invalidCode(s *discordgo.Session, i *discordgo.InteractionCreate, userEmail
CustomID: continueSlug,
Label: "yes",
Style: discordgo.SuccessButton,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"✔️",
},
},
discordgo.Button{
CustomID: quitSlug,
Label: "no",
Style: discordgo.DangerButton,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"✖️",
},
},
Expand Down Expand Up @@ -634,15 +634,15 @@ func invalidRITEmail(s *discordgo.Session, i *discordgo.InteractionCreate, userE
CustomID: continueSlug,
Label: "yes",
Style: discordgo.SuccessButton,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"✔️",
},
},
discordgo.Button{
CustomID: quitSlug,
Label: "no",
Style: discordgo.DangerButton,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"✖️",
},
},
Expand Down Expand Up @@ -787,15 +787,15 @@ func hasRITEmail(s *discordgo.Session, i *discordgo.InteractionCreate, ctx ddtra
CustomID: yesSlug,
Label: "Yes",
Style: discordgo.SuccessButton,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"✔️",
},
},
discordgo.Button{
CustomID: noSlug,
Label: "No",
Style: discordgo.DangerButton,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"✖️",
},
},
Expand Down Expand Up @@ -960,39 +960,39 @@ func manualVerification(s *discordgo.Session, i *discordgo.InteractionCreate, us
CustomID: memberSlug,
Label: "Member",
Style: discordgo.SuccessButton,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"✔️",
},
},
discordgo.Button{
CustomID: externalSlug,
Label: "External",
Style: discordgo.PrimaryButton,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"❓",
},
},
discordgo.Button{
CustomID: prosectiveSlug,
Label: "Prospective",
Style: discordgo.PrimaryButton,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"👶",
},
},
discordgo.Button{
CustomID: staffSlug,
Label: "Staff",
Style: discordgo.PrimaryButton,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"👨‍🏫",
},
},
discordgo.Button{
CustomID: alumniSlug,
Label: "Alumni",
Style: discordgo.PrimaryButton,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"🧓",
},
},
Expand All @@ -1004,7 +1004,7 @@ func manualVerification(s *discordgo.Session, i *discordgo.InteractionCreate, us
CustomID: denySlug,
Label: "Deny",
Style: discordgo.DangerButton,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"✖️",
},
},
Expand Down
2 changes: 1 addition & 1 deletion commands/slash/signin.go
Original file line number Diff line number Diff line change
Expand Up @@ -246,7 +246,7 @@ func Signin() (*discordgo.ApplicationCommand, func(s *discordgo.Session, i *disc
Label: "Signin",
Style: discordgo.SuccessButton,
CustomID: signinSlug,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"📝",
},
},
Expand Down
11 changes: 6 additions & 5 deletions commands/slash/vote.go
Original file line number Diff line number Diff line change
Expand Up @@ -242,7 +242,7 @@ func Vote() (*discordgo.ApplicationCommand, func(s *discordgo.Session, i *discor
Label: "Vote",
Style: discordgo.SuccessButton,
CustomID: voteSlug,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: "🗳️",
},
},
Expand Down Expand Up @@ -381,15 +381,13 @@ func voteGetVote(s *discordgo.Session, i *discordgo.InteractionCreate, rawOption
emojis := []string{
"🟥",
"🟧",
"🟨",
"🟩",
"🟦",
"🟪",
"⬛",
"⬜",
"🟥",
"🟧",
"🟨",
"🟩",
"🟦",
"🟪",
Expand All @@ -413,7 +411,7 @@ func voteGetVote(s *discordgo.Session, i *discordgo.InteractionCreate, rawOption
innerOptions = append(innerOptions, discordgo.SelectMenuOption{
Label: option,
Value: option,
Emoji: discordgo.ComponentEmoji{
Emoji: &discordgo.ComponentEmoji{
Name: emojis[j],
},
})
Expand Down Expand Up @@ -449,10 +447,13 @@ func voteGetVote(s *discordgo.Session, i *discordgo.InteractionCreate, rawOption
CustomID: messageSlug,
Options: func() []discordgo.SelectMenuOption {
var innerOptions []discordgo.SelectMenuOption
for _, option := range options {
for j, option := range options {
innerOptions = append(innerOptions, discordgo.SelectMenuOption{
Label: option,
Value: option,
Emoji: &discordgo.ComponentEmoji{
Name: emojis[j],
},
})
}
return innerOptions
Expand Down
10 changes: 5 additions & 5 deletions go.mod
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,7 @@ go 1.20

require (
entgo.io/ent v0.12.1
github.com/bwmarrin/discordgo v0.27.1
github.com/bwmarrin/discordgo v0.28.1
github.com/fsnotify/fsnotify v1.6.0
github.com/gin-gonic/gin v1.9.1
github.com/google/uuid v1.3.0
Expand Down Expand Up @@ -54,7 +54,7 @@ require (
github.com/google/s2a-go v0.1.3 // indirect
github.com/googleapis/enterprise-certificate-proxy v0.2.3 // indirect
github.com/googleapis/gax-go/v2 v2.8.0 // indirect
github.com/gorilla/websocket v1.5.0 // indirect
github.com/gorilla/websocket v1.5.1 // indirect
github.com/hashicorp/hcl v1.0.0 // indirect
github.com/hashicorp/hcl/v2 v2.13.0 // indirect
github.com/joho/godotenv v1.4.0 // indirect
Expand Down Expand Up @@ -89,10 +89,10 @@ require (
go4.org/intern v0.0.0-20211027215823-ae77deb06f29 // indirect
go4.org/unsafe/assume-no-moving-gc v0.0.0-20220617031537-928513b29760 // indirect
golang.org/x/arch v0.3.0 // indirect
golang.org/x/crypto v0.17.0 // indirect
golang.org/x/crypto v0.22.0 // indirect
golang.org/x/mod v0.8.0 // indirect
golang.org/x/net v0.17.0 // indirect
golang.org/x/sys v0.15.0 // indirect
golang.org/x/net v0.24.0 // indirect
golang.org/x/sys v0.19.0 // indirect
golang.org/x/text v0.14.0 // indirect
golang.org/x/time v0.3.0 // indirect
golang.org/x/xerrors v0.0.0-20220907171357-04be3eba64a2 // indirect
Expand Down
Loading

0 comments on commit d88d951

Please sign in to comment.